tests/testthat/test-est_marg_lik.R

test_that("use, JC69, strict, Yule", {

  if (!can_run_mcbette()) return()

  marg_lik <- est_marg_lik(
    fasta_filename = system.file("extdata", "simple.fas", package = "mcbette"),
    inference_model = beautier::create_test_ns_inference_model(),
    beast2_options = beastier::create_mcbette_beast2_options()
  )

  # A list
  expect_true(is.list(marg_lik))

  # with the right elements
  expect_true("marg_log_lik" %in% names(marg_lik))
  expect_true("marg_log_lik_sd" %in% names(marg_lik))
  expect_true("ess" %in% names(marg_lik))

  # elements have the right data type
  expect_true(beautier::is_one_double(marg_lik$marg_log_lik))
  expect_true(beautier::is_one_double(marg_lik$marg_log_lik_sd))
  expect_true(beautier::is_one_double(marg_lik$ess))

  # elements have the right values
  expect_true(marg_lik$marg_log_lik < 0.0)
  expect_true(marg_lik$marg_log_lik_sd > 0.0)
  expect_true(marg_lik$ess > 0.0)
})

test_that("more particles, less sd", {

  if (!can_run_mcbette()) return()

  fasta_filename <- system.file("extdata", "simple.fas", package = "mcbette")
  inference_model_1 <- beautier::create_test_ns_inference_model(
    mcmc = create_ns_mcmc(
      particle_count = 1
    )
  )
  inference_model_10 <- beautier::create_test_ns_inference_model(
    mcmc = create_ns_mcmc(
      particle_count = 10
    )
  )
  beast2_options <- beastier::create_mcbette_beast2_options(
    rng_seed = 314
  )

  marg_lik_high_sd <- est_marg_lik(
    fasta_filename = fasta_filename,
    inference_model = inference_model_1,
    beast2_options = beast2_options
  )
  marg_lik_low_sd <- est_marg_lik(
    fasta_filename = fasta_filename,
    inference_model = inference_model_10,
    beast2_options = beast2_options
  )
  expect_lt(
    marg_lik_low_sd$marg_log_lik_sd,
    marg_lik_high_sd$marg_log_lik_sd
  )
})
